Colchicine in Coronary Artery Bypass Graft (CABG)
RandomizedParallel-groupQuadruple-blindTreatment
Summary
There is evidence that inflammatory processes may play a key role during surgical myocardial reperfusion. The hypothesis of this study is that colchicine, an anti-inflammatory agent, may lead to reduction in periprocedural infarct size, when administered during elective coronary artery bypass graft surgery.
